Summary

CVE-2023-29175 is an improper certificate validation vulnerability (CWE-295) that affects FortiOS versions 6.2, 6.4, and 7.0.0 through 7.0.10, as well as FortiProxy versions 1.2, 2.0, and 7.0.0 through 7.0.9, and 7.2.0 through 7.2.3. This vulnerability could be exploited by a remote and unauthenticated attacker to perform a Man-in-the-Middle attack on the communication channel between the vulnerable device and the remote FortiGuard's map server. To remediate this vulnerability, users should update their FortiOS and FortiProxy installations to the latest available versions provided by Fortinet. The potential danger posed by this vulnerability to an organization includes interception of sensitive information transmitted over the compromised communication channel, potential data breaches, and unauthorized access to network resources.
